Yungblud repped both the “Godfather of Punk” and the “Godfather of Metal” at the MTV Video Music Awards on Sunday night (September 7th). The UK singer wore Iggy Pop’s pants and Ozzy Osbourne’s necklace at the ceremony at the UBS Arena in Elmont, New York.
Get Yungblud Tickets Here
On the red carpet of the VMAs, Yungblud told Nylon magazine, “I’ve actually got Iggy Pop’s leather pants on. Richard [Stark] from [luxury brand] Chrome Hearts said if you can fit in them you can wear them.” Meanwhile, the singer’s cross necklace was gifted him by Ozzy himself at the “Back to the Beginning” concert in July, just two weeks before the Prince of Darkness passed away.
In addition to his fashion statement, Yungblud also performed as part of a musical tribute to Ozzy, singing “Crazy Train” and “Changes,” and joining Steven Tyler on “Mama, I’m Coming Home.” While Ariana Grande was blown away by the performance, The Darkness guitarist Dan Hawkins was not a fan.
